支持 SATA 的微控制器

电器工程 微控制器 数据
2022-01-29 00:53:13

是否有支持将数据写入大型 SATA 磁盘的微控制器?

3个回答

另一种选择可能是带有 USB2 HS 主机的高端 MCU,并使用 USB-SATA 适配器。

SATA 在非常高的频率下工作。如果我查看此数据连接器表,我基本上会看到带有差分信号的 TX/RX 连接,因为速度非常快。需要处理 1.5Gbit 的数据,即 1.5GHz 信号。我觉得微控制器的处理速度非常快。

我最好的选择是获得一个 SATA 到 PATA 转换器并使用 PATA 接口。它降低了查看位所需的速度,因为数据是以并行方式提供的。这仍然是更简单的工作方式。

我不知道您是否还想为此使用微控制器。我认为 FPGA 可能会成为此类项目中更好的选择,但这取决于您的目标。

三思而后行:您还需要一个用于大磁盘的文件系统,而 FAT32 有一些设计限制,尤其是。文件必须小于 4GB。其他文件系统在 µC 上实现起来要困难得多。在大多数情况下,它更容易使用 SD 卡,因为它支持 SPI。